Let's talk about Xen. Was it really that bad?

>> No.4463338

Yes and no.

-The big teleporter/entering Xen was good
-Using the long jump hinted at in the tutorial was cool
-The levels are generally quite interesting and varied
-It's the hardest part of the game
-It has good atmosphere and the build up of going to space was satisfying

-It can be confusing and overwhelming
-The Gonarch fight is alright but can be buggy
-Nhilanth can be frustrating with the teleport attack
-The platforming in that manta ray area is too annoying
-The factory part is also too annoying
